
Rozpoczynając przygodę z projektowaniem stron WWW, warto zrozumieć podstawowe zasady i etapy tego procesu. Pierwszym krokiem jest określenie celu strony, co pozwoli na lepsze dostosowanie jej do potrzeb użytkowników. Niezależnie od tego, czy tworzysz stronę dla siebie, czy dla klienta, kluczowe jest zdefiniowanie grupy docelowej oraz ich oczekiwań. Następnie warto przeprowadzić badania konkurencji, aby zobaczyć, co działa w danej branży i jakie są aktualne trendy. Kolejnym etapem jest stworzenie planu lub makiety strony, która pomoże wizualizować układ elementów oraz ich funkcjonalność. Warto również zastanowić się nad wyborem technologii i narzędzi, które będą używane do budowy strony. Czy zdecydujesz się na system zarządzania treścią, taki jak WordPress, czy może chcesz stworzyć stronę od podstaw przy użyciu HTML i CSS?
Jakie umiejętności są potrzebne do projektowania stron WWW?
Aby skutecznie projektować strony WWW, niezbędne jest posiadanie pewnych umiejętności technicznych oraz kreatywnych. Podstawową umiejętnością jest znajomość języków programowania takich jak HTML, CSS oraz JavaScript. HTML służy do strukturyzacji treści na stronie, CSS odpowiada za stylizację i wygląd, natomiast JavaScript dodaje interaktywność. Oprócz umiejętności programistycznych warto również znać zasady UX/UI designu, które pomagają w tworzeniu przyjaznych dla użytkownika interfejsów. Zrozumienie psychologii użytkownika oraz jego zachowań na stronie ma kluczowe znaczenie dla efektywności projektu. Dodatkowo pomocne mogą być umiejętności związane z grafiką komputerową oraz edycją zdjęć, co pozwoli na tworzenie atrakcyjnych wizualnie elementów. Warto również zaznajomić się z narzędziami do prototypowania i projektowania graficznego, takimi jak Adobe XD czy Figma.
Jakie narzędzia są najlepsze do projektowania stron WWW?

Wybór odpowiednich narzędzi do projektowania stron WWW ma ogromne znaczenie dla efektywności pracy oraz jakości końcowego produktu. Istnieje wiele programów i aplikacji dostępnych na rynku, które mogą ułatwić proces tworzenia strony. Do najpopularniejszych narzędzi należy edytor kodu, który pozwala na pisanie i edytowanie kodu źródłowego strony. Przykłady to Visual Studio Code czy Sublime Text. W przypadku osób preferujących bardziej wizualne podejście do projektowania świetnie sprawdzą się programy takie jak Adobe XD czy Sketch, które umożliwiają tworzenie prototypów oraz interaktywnych makiet. Ważnym aspektem jest również wybór systemu zarządzania treścią (CMS), jeśli planujesz regularnie aktualizować zawartość strony. WordPress jest jednym z najpopularniejszych CMS-ów dzięki swojej elastyczności i bogatej bazie wtyczek. Nie można zapomnieć o narzędziach analitycznych takich jak Google Analytics, które pomogą monitorować ruch na stronie oraz zachowanie użytkowników.
Jakie są najważniejsze zasady dobrego projektowania stron WWW?
Podczas projektowania stron WWW istnieje wiele zasad, które warto mieć na uwadze, aby stworzyć funkcjonalny i estetyczny produkt. Przede wszystkim kluczowe jest zapewnienie responsywności strony, co oznacza, że powinna ona dobrze wyglądać i działać zarówno na komputerach stacjonarnych, jak i urządzeniach mobilnych. Użytkownicy oczekują szybkiego ładowania strony, dlatego optymalizacja obrazów oraz minimalizacja kodu to istotne aspekty procesu projektowania. Kolejną ważną zasadą jest intuicyjna nawigacja – użytkownicy powinni łatwo odnajdywać interesujące ich treści bez zbędnego wysiłku. Dobrze zaprojektowane menu oraz logiczny układ sekcji mogą znacznie poprawić doświadczenia użytkowników na stronie. Estetyka również ma znaczenie; stosowanie spójnej kolorystyki oraz typografii wpływa na postrzeganie marki przez odwiedzających. Warto także pamiętać o dostępności – strona powinna być użyteczna dla wszystkich użytkowników, w tym osób z niepełnosprawnościami.
Jakie są najczęstsze błędy w projektowaniu stron WWW?
Podczas tworzenia stron WWW, łatwo jest popełnić błędy, które mogą wpłynąć na ich funkcjonalność oraz odbiór przez użytkowników. Jednym z najczęstszych problemów jest zbyt skomplikowany układ strony, który może przytłoczyć odwiedzających. Zbyt wiele elementów na stronie głównej może sprawić, że użytkownicy będą mieli trudności z odnalezieniem potrzebnych informacji. Kolejnym powszechnym błędem jest brak responsywności, co oznacza, że strona nie dostosowuje się do różnych rozmiarów ekranów. W dzisiejszych czasach, gdy coraz więcej osób korzysta z urządzeń mobilnych, jest to niezwykle istotne. Inny problem to długi czas ładowania strony; jeśli strona ładuje się zbyt wolno, użytkownicy mogą szybko ją opuścić. Niezoptymalizowane obrazy oraz nieefektywny kod mogą znacząco wpływać na wydajność. Dodatkowo, brak jasnej i intuicyjnej nawigacji może prowadzić do frustracji użytkowników, którzy nie mogą znaleźć tego, czego szukają. Warto także unikać nadmiernego używania efektów wizualnych i animacji, które mogą rozpraszać uwagę i spowalniać działanie strony.
Jakie są aktualne trendy w projektowaniu stron WWW?
Projektowanie stron WWW ewoluuje w szybkim tempie, a śledzenie aktualnych trendów jest kluczowe dla tworzenia nowoczesnych i atrakcyjnych witryn. Obecnie jednym z najważniejszych trendów jest minimalizm; prostota w designie pozwala na skupienie uwagi na treści i funkcjonalności strony. Użytkownicy preferują czyste układy z dużą ilością białej przestrzeni, co ułatwia przyswajanie informacji. Kolejnym istotnym trendem jest wykorzystanie animacji i mikrointerakcji, które dodają dynamiki i interaktywności do doświadczeń użytkowników. Dzięki nim strona staje się bardziej angażująca i przyjemna w obsłudze. Ważnym aspektem jest również personalizacja treści; dzięki analizie danych o użytkownikach można dostarczać im bardziej dopasowane informacje oraz oferty. Trendem rosnącym na znaczeniu jest także dark mode, czyli ciemny motyw graficzny, który cieszy się popularnością ze względu na swoje zalety dla oczu oraz oszczędność energii w urządzeniach mobilnych. Nie można zapominać o dostępności – projektowanie stron z myślą o osobach z niepełnosprawnościami staje się coraz bardziej powszechne i doceniane.
Jakie są najlepsze praktyki SEO w projektowaniu stron WWW?
Optymalizacja pod kątem wyszukiwarek internetowych (SEO) to kluczowy element projektowania stron WWW, który wpływa na widoczność witryny w wynikach wyszukiwania. Jedną z podstawowych praktyk SEO jest odpowiednie dobieranie słów kluczowych; należy przeprowadzić badania dotyczące fraz, które są najczęściej wyszukiwane przez potencjalnych odwiedzających. Umieszczanie tych słów kluczowych w strategicznych miejscach takich jak nagłówki, opisy obrazków czy meta opisy ma ogromne znaczenie dla poprawy pozycji strony w wynikach wyszukiwania. Kolejnym istotnym aspektem jest struktura URL – powinny być one krótkie, zrozumiałe oraz zawierać słowa kluczowe związane z treścią strony. Ważne jest również zapewnienie szybkiego ładowania strony; Google bierze pod uwagę czas ładowania jako czynnik rankingowy. Optymalizacja obrazków oraz minimalizacja kodu HTML i CSS to praktyki, które mogą znacząco poprawić wydajność witryny. Dodatkowo warto zadbać o linki wewnętrzne oraz zewnętrzne – prowadzenie do innych wartościowych treści zarówno wewnątrz swojej witryny, jak i poza nią zwiększa jej autorytet w oczach wyszukiwarek.
Jakie są różnice między projektowaniem a rozwijaniem stron WWW?
Projektowanie i rozwijanie stron WWW to dwa różne etapy procesu tworzenia witryny, które często są mylone ze sobą. Projektowanie koncentruje się głównie na estetyce oraz użyteczności strony; obejmuje takie elementy jak układ graficzny, kolorystyka czy typografia. Projektanci muszą mieć umiejętności związane z UX/UI designem oraz znajomość narzędzi do prototypowania i edycji grafiki. Ich celem jest stworzenie atrakcyjnego wizualnie interfejsu, który będzie intuicyjny dla użytkowników i odpowiadał ich potrzebom. Z kolei rozwijanie stron WWW koncentruje się na technicznych aspektach budowy witryny; programiści zajmują się pisaniem kodu oraz implementacją funkcjonalności zgodnie z wymaganiami projektu. Muszą znać języki programowania takie jak HTML, CSS oraz JavaScript oraz być zaznajomieni z frameworkami i systemami zarządzania treścią. W praktyce obie te dziedziny często współpracują ze sobą; projektanci przekazują swoje pomysły programistom, którzy następnie realizują je w formie działającej strony internetowej.
Jakie są zalety korzystania z systemów zarządzania treścią?
Korzystanie z systemów zarządzania treścią (CMS) ma wiele zalet dla osób zajmujących się projektowaniem stron WWW. Przede wszystkim CMS-y umożliwiają łatwe zarządzanie treścią bez konieczności posiadania zaawansowanych umiejętności programistycznych. Dzięki intuicyjnym interfejsom użytkownicy mogą dodawać nowe artykuły, zdjęcia czy filmy bez potrzeby pisania kodu HTML lub CSS. To znacznie przyspiesza proces aktualizacji witryny oraz pozwala na bieżąco dostosowywać jej zawartość do potrzeb odwiedzających. Kolejną zaletą CMS-ów jest możliwość korzystania z gotowych szablonów oraz motywów graficznych, co ułatwia stworzenie estetycznej strony bez potrzeby angażowania grafika czy projektanta. Systemy te często oferują również szeroką gamę wtyczek i rozszerzeń, które pozwalają na dodawanie nowych funkcjonalności do witryny bez konieczności pisania kodu od podstaw. Dodatkowo CMS-y często mają wbudowane narzędzia SEO, co ułatwia optymalizację strony pod kątem wyszukiwarek internetowych.
Jakie są różnice między frontendem a backendem w projektowaniu stron WWW?
W świecie projektowania stron WWW istnieją dwie główne kategorie pracy: frontend i backend, które pełnią różne funkcje w procesie tworzenia witryn internetowych. Frontend odnosi się do części strony widocznej dla użytkowników; obejmuje wszystkie elementy wizualne oraz interaktywne aspekty interfejsu użytkownika. Frontend developerzy pracują głównie z językami takimi jak HTML, CSS oraz JavaScript; ich zadaniem jest zapewnienie atrakcyjnego wyglądu strony oraz intuicyjnej nawigacji dla odwiedzających. Z kolei backend dotyczy części serwerowej aplikacji; backend developerzy zajmują się logiką działania strony oraz zarządzaniem bazami danych. Pracują oni głównie z językami programowania takimi jak PHP, Python czy Ruby oraz korzystają z systemów baz danych takich jak MySQL czy MongoDB.